#724d3d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#724d3d is composed of 44.7% red, 30.2% green and 23.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 32.5% magenta, 46.5% yellow and 55.3% black. It has a hue angle of 18.1 degrees, a saturation of 30.3% and a lightness of 34.3%. #724d3d color hex could be obtained by blending #e49a7a with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#666633.

Shades and Tints of #724d3d

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0c0806 is the darkest color, while #fefefe is the lightest one.

Tones of #724d3d

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#5e5551 is the less saturated color, while #af3500 is the most saturated one.
